One comment... I think you should try to stand out of the crowd. There's a LOT of people producing general clothing with decent designs, targeted on a specific market.
If you want to make this successfull, you've got to have products (not really designs only) which really are different. Think of FIA approved Nomex stuff with prints etc.
Good luck with the venture!!
